Frequently Asked Questions about Oshkosh
How much are Studio apartments in Oshkosh?
There are currently 15 Studio Apartments in Oshkosh with rent ranges from $695 to $1,350 with an average price of $997.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Oshkosh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Oshkosh ranges from $490 to $3,201 with an average monthly rent of $1,186.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Oshkosh c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Oshkosh range from $700 to $4,050.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,551.
How expensive are Oshkosh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 50 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Oshkosh on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$495 to $2,749 - averaging $1,627 for the location.
